Shraddha Murder Case: Delhi Police can file charge sheet in Saket court today

In the Shraddha Walkar case that shook the nation, the Delhi Police may soon file a case against the accused Aftab Amin Poonawalla. Now information is coming that the Delhi Police may file a charge sheet before the Saket District Court on Tuesday i.e. January 24, 2023. According to news agency IANS, Delhi Police may file a charge sheet in the Shraddha Walker murder case before the Saket district court on Tuesday. The charge sheet is expected to run into over 3,000 pages with 100 witnesses in the case. Forensic and electronic evidence has also been included in this charge sheet, sources said. In the charge sheet, the police have also referred to the DNA reports of the hair and bone samples recovered from a forest in Mehrauli on January 4, which confirmed that these were Shraddha's bones.

On January 6, through an application moved by the lawyer of Poonawalla, accused in the murder case, seeking release of money from his bank account, saying that he did not have enough warm clothes to combat the cold inside the jail, the court He had also directed the jail authorities to provide warm clothes to him.

Aftab was produced before Metropolitan Magistrate Aviral Shukla, where he demanded a law book to read. The court had on January 10 extended his judicial custody by 14 days. Aftab Poonawalla is accused of strangulating his live-in partner Shraddha Walkar to death in Delhi's Chhatarpur area on May 18 last year and dismembering her body into several pieces and throwing it in a forest in Mehrauli area.
